Not likely getting a bad TPS.Your TPS runs off a 5volt reference wire.Using multimeter with key on engine off Check to make sure you have your 5volt reference check for any deformed terminals or broken wires inside insulation.

NOt an expert but my guess is no. First an airbag uses essentially a powder charge to deploy the airbag. Installation and removal is not recommended for joe shade tree mechanic,it can be dangerous. Secondly all that installation has to have a place to mount and a spot inthe dashboard through which it can deploy. Chances are it if didn't come with one an airbag would have no place to "live". If it is even possible to have it done it would probably approach 50% of the value of the typical car that age. Good luck.
